What is Chromotherapy in Bath Products?
Chromotherapy, also known as colour therapy, is a practice rooted in the idea that different colours can influence mood, energy levels, and overall wellbeing. In the context of bath products, chromotherapy is applied using integrated LED lighting systems within whirlpools, steam cabins, or even shower enclosures. These lights shift through a spectrum of calming or energising colours, depending on the desired effect.
For instance, soft blues and cool violets can help reduce mental fatigue and calm the nervous system, making them ideal for bedtime routines. On the other hand, warmer hues like orange or yellow can energise the body and are better suited for morning rituals.
When combined with the sensory elements of water, pressure, temperature, and motion, chromotherapy bath products offer a multi-sensory experience that goes far beyond ordinary bathing.

How to Use Chromotherapy in Bath Products for Better Sleep?
If sleep is your main goal, using chromotherapy bath products effectively involves more than just turning on coloured lights. These simple steps will help you get the most out of your experience:
Pick the Right Time
Try incorporating chromotherapy into your evening bath, ideally 1 to 2 hours before bedtime. This helps lower your body temperature naturally and signals to your brain that it’s time to unwind.
Choose Calming Colours
When choosing the right lighting, opt for blue, violet, or soft green lighting. These shades have a cooling effect on the mind and promote tranquillity.
Keep the Temperature Moderate
Warm (but not hot) water works best when paired with calming chromotherapy as it helps relax muscles without stimulating the body.
Stay Consistent
You’ll find that making this a regular part of your evening routine helps signal to your body that it's time to rest, making chromotherapy for better sleep feel both natural and necessary.
